Apart from a resurrected Agent Coulson, Marvel's 'Agents of S.H.I.E.L.D.' excites us the most for its ability to tie into the Marvel Cinematic Universe on a weekly basis, rather than waiting for each individual movie. So, which of Marvel's upcoming slate will have the most direct tie into 'Agents of S.H.I.E.L.D.?' Why, 'Captain America: The Winter Soldier,' says series star Clark Gregg!

Speaking to IGN on everything from 'Much Ado About Nothing' to 'The Avengers 2,' Gregg explained that his own excitement for 'Agents of S.H.I.E.L.D.' stemmed from the ability to flesh out future Marvel movies, specifically mentioning 'Captain America 2' as a point of connection.

"The exciting part is going to be seeing the way that Agents of S.H.I.E.L.D. interacts with the S.H.I.E.L.D. component in Captain America 2, and the other movies, and whether those movies will then effect our show," said Gregg. "Marvel uses everything at their disposal and that nothing will happen on our show that will not impact, or be impacted by, the movies."

More specifically, Gregg teased that 'Agents of S.H.I.E.L.D.' would see his character Phil Coulson in a leadership role, taking on a "ragtag" group to deal with old and new S.H.I.E.L.D. business off the radar. After all, the events of 'The Avengers' drastically changed the landscape for extraordinary people among the world:

Most specifically in a world after The Avengers where suddenly the world has watched the battle of New York and they know about Asgard, and they know about Chitauri, and alien invaders and superheroes and there's a lot of people who want in.

As for the biggest question of all, Gregg revealed that the pilot episode of 'Agents of S.H.I.E.L.D.' would see some manner of explanation for Coulson's return from the dead, but whether or not that explanation proves true will remain to be seen.
